Basis · Amendments and terminations supersede the original report for the same registrant, client and period, so a revised quarter is counted once at its latest filed value. Registration-only filings carry no activity money and are excluded from these totals.

Note · A filing names one to several issue areas and reports a single dollar figure for the period, so the same money appears beside every issue that filing declares. The dollar column is therefore spend on filings that named this issue — it is not a split of the total, and these figures sum above it. Filing counts do not double-count.
